Ok here goes...

8oz Plain or SR flour
2oz Cocoa powder
4oz Sugar
4oz Melted Marg

Mix all dry ingrediants together and add melted marg (which must be runny).
Mix well until mixture is fairly stiff. Press into a 7inch sponge tin.
Brush top with water and sprinkle with sugar.

Cook for 30 minutes at ..

Electric 340 (don't know what the equiv is need to find out)

Gas mark 2 1/2 approx

You must have had it at school. It's like a really rock hard chocolate cake although sometimes it is a bit soft depending on who cooked it i think.

It is fantastic.
